Understanding the Double Axis Hydraulic Knee Joint

A double axis hydraulic knee joint is a specialized component designed for individuals who have lost their lower limbs. What makes it unique is its ability to mimic natural knee motion through a hydraulic system that adjusts resistance based on the user’s speed and gait. This makes walking not only feasible but also more comfortable and efficient. However, with advancements come concerns about cost, adjustability, and maintenance.

Identifying Customer Pain Points

Cost Concerns

One major concern is the price tag associated with these knee joints. On average, double axis hydraulic knee joints can range from $10,000 to $20,000. This hefty price can be alarming, especially when insurance coverage is limited. Customers often worry if they can find a knee joint that fits their budget without sacrificing quality.

Adjustability and Fit

Another common issue is related to adjustability. Many customers express frustration at not understanding how to properly adjust the knee joint for their specific needs. It's pivotal for the joint to adapt to the user’s daily activities—whether they are walking, jogging, or climbing stairs. Without proper adjustments, the user may face discomfort or limited mobility.

Maintenance and Durability

Lastly, the concern regarding maintenance and long-term durability is prevalent. Many prospective buyers fear that the knee joint will require frequent repairs or replacements, leading to unexpected costs in the future. This worry can prevent customers from confidently making a purchase.

Prioritize Durability and Maintenance

To alleviate concerns about maintenance, look for knee joints with warranties that cover essential parts and services. Many brands offer warranties ranging from 2 to 5 years. Additionally, inquire about the material used in the knee joint. For instance, models made from high-grade aluminum or titanium tend to be more durable and resistant to wear and tear. A study found that users of titanium-based knee joints reported significantly fewer mechanical failures compared to those using standard materials.
